The Kazakhstan-Russia Interregional Cooperation Forum continues its work in Omsk. The large-scale event is attended by delegations from Kazakhstan and Russia, including representatives of government agencies, businessmen, economists, and cultural associations. Kazakhstan is represented by delegations from several regions, who are holding working meetings and negotiations with Russian companies and government agencies. This was reported by Qazaqyia.kz citing Sputnik Kazakhstan.

Akim of East Kazakhstan Region Nurymbet Saktaganov held working meetings within the forum. During a meeting with Vice-Governor of Orenburg Region Anton Efimov, a memorandum of cooperation was signed between East Kazakhstan Region and the government of Orenburg Region. The document is aimed at strengthening good-neighborly relations and developing cooperation in economic and humanitarian spheres. As a sign of friendship and partnership, the parties exchanged commemorative gifts reflecting the culture and traditions of the two regions, the akimat of East Kazakhstan Region reported.

During negotiations with Deputy Chairman of the Samara Region Government Pavel Fink, the akim discussed opportunities for joint projects in tourism, education, and digital solutions.
